Ingomar is an unincorporated community in northwestern Rosebud County, Montana, United States, along the route of U.S. Route 12. [1] The town was established in 1908, as a station stop on the Chicago, Milwaukee, St. Paul and Pacific Railroad , then under construction in Montana. [ 2 ]

A payment in lieu of taxes, abbreviated as PILT or PILOT, [1] [2] [3] is a payment made to compensate a government for some or all of the property tax revenue lost due to tax exempt ownership or use of real property.
